Comment (by anevilyak):

 Without specifics on the exact hardware in that HP machine, I'm afraid
 this ticket is more or less completely useless since it gives absolutely
 no information relevant to actually tracking down what the problem might
 be. It could be an unsupported disk controller, it could be IRQs not being
 properly configured by the BIOS and thus not being able to init the
 controller correctly or a number of other things. A device list or serial
 log from the machine would be a good starting point.
